Department of Curriculum, Foundations, and Reading


The Department of Curriculum, Foundations, and Reading provides a service function to all other programs in the College. Undergraduate and graduate level courses are offered in the areas of educational foundations, educational psychology, curriculum theory and development, reading education, and educational research. The Department also offers several graduate degree programs: a master’s degree program in reading education and in evaluation, assessment, research, and learning; an education specialist degree program in reading education; and a doctoral degree program in curriculum studies. In addition to degree programs, the department offers the reading endorsement, the urban education endorsement and graduate certificates in applied research and evaluation and in curriculum and pedagogy for social justice.

The department provides the urban education undergraduate endorsement and courses for all other programs in the College of Education. Undergraduate courses are offered in the areas of educational foundations, educational psychology, reading education, and educational research. The department also provides three pre-professional block (PPB) courses.
